Malaysians aren't just online shoppers; they're among the world's most confident and frequent cross-border consumers. A new study by Airwallex and Statista found 94% of Malaysians are confident in buying from international merchants, and 72% do so at least once a month, far outpacing global averages.
Aren Yip, Malaysia Country Manager at Airwallex, joins us to unpack what's driving this borderless shopping culture. He discusses the outsized role of influencers, the critical importance of localised payments, and the ‘mental hurdles’ local SMEs must overcome to seize this massive international opportunity.
We discuss:
Why Malaysians are more confident and frequent cross-border shoppers than the global average.
The three drivers of this trend: global media, sales promotions, and trust.
The outsized role of influencers, with 76% of Malaysians swayed by them.
The critical importance of localised payments (like FPX and e-wallets) for conversion.
The opportunities and ‘mental hurdles’ for Malaysian SMEs looking to export.
